On the third day of our trip, we got up for an early breakfast on the terrace with the glorious view, overlooking the forest lake.

But as it promised to be another sunny and warm summer day, we had no desire to stay at our hotel, rather we packed our bags fast after breakfast and started on our way further into Gauja National Park - Ligatne.

Ligatne is a historic town, built around a paper mill nearly 200 years ago. So many of the places we visited here are part of the historic Paper Mill Village.

If one drives into Ligatne center, he will come across beautiful forests above sandstone cliffs, which can also be seen on the photos.

There are both natural and man-made caves in the sandstone cliffs, forming astonishing shapes, and all that in a naturally beautiful environment - there's always a river or a viewing platform near, if not both.

In this case, there was even a table with goods, snacks and foods(can be seen behind the bush in the topmost of the 3 photos above). For tourists? Who knows. Anyway, as the temperatures were around 30 degrees Celsius, we decided not to touch the food.

Circling around, we got to the other side of the Ligatne river and there we came to the man-made cellars in the cliffs. As Ligatne has the highest amount of sandstone cliffs in Latvia, it's only natural, peole would take advantage of it and store their food and other goods there, due to the easy nature of sandstone carving.

This tradition has been going on for as long as there is history. Some of these holes could be ancient!

And behind the rivers and the sandstone cellars - more stairs, more climbing. But the nature is beautiful here and I really want a view from the viewing platform up top, so up we go.

This forest is probably perfect for mushrooms as well, so if we hadn't been so exhausted from constant climbing and the heat, we probably would have gone for a nice walk in the woods - you see, Ligante is also famous for it's hiking trails.

Afrer we climbed down, we drove a tad further, only to see the original paper mill area sealed off. This looks like the perfect place to explore - old buildings with a story to tell, overlooking the beautiful forest and the Ligatne river. Unfortunately, the gates remained locked for us this time.

We drove back towards the other side of the old town and visited the older part of the papermill, the Handfabrik, where paper was manufactured mainly by hand. Later the manufacturing moved to the other side of the town and leaving only subsidiary functions here.

One can see the system of sluices built onto the riverdam and the cliff in the back, filled with cellars, rooms and who-knows-what-purpose holes.

And more stairs! More climbing. But again, a viewing platform up top, that promises a spectacular view, caught our eye.

Of course we had to peak into the holes as well, alas the holes in this cliff were all deserted. If something was stored here once, it's long gone.

But the hard climb usually pays off, and luckily this time we got rewarded as well.

The views are magnificient. And what's more curious, is that there are no hordes of tourists cramping the area. One other car with a family only pulls up.

After taking a few moments to enjoy ourselves, we headed downwards and our trip back home started, with mandatory breaks at the beaches of Salacgriva.
